First Lathering with Jayaruh #353

I used Razorock Classic Artisan Shaving Soap for my initial latherings of new brushes. This brush has a Badger/Boar 70/30 mix knot from Maggards. I use my green bowl for the first latherings.


I wet the brush, shook it off, and loaded it for 30 seconds.


I added a bit of water to the bowl and worked it for 30 seconds.


I added a little water to the bowl and worked it for another 30 seconds.


After a little water, I worked the brush for the third and final thirty seconds.


After the final round of working the lather, this is what I ended up with.


I set it on the container to soak it in for about 30 minutes.

I cleaned up the bowl and returned to the brush after 30 minutes.

Here it is after rinsing the brush and painting it dry.

Now, it is ready to rest and air dry.
